Exploring the Physics: Understanding the Crystal Structures and Properties of Silicon Carbide

Silicon Carbide (SiC) is far more than just a hard material; it's a fascinating semiconductor whose unique properties stem from its complex crystal structures and the inherent characteristics of its silicon and carbon atoms. Understanding the physics behind SiC, particularly its various polytypes and their resultant properties, is key to appreciating its diverse applications, from advanced electronics to high-performance industrial materials.

At its core, SiC is a compound semiconductor formed by silicon and carbon atoms arranged in a crystal lattice. What makes SiC particularly interesting is its polymorphism – the ability to exist in multiple crystalline forms, known as polytypes. These polytypes arise from different stacking sequences of the silicon-carbon bilayers. The most common polytypes are 3C-SiC, 4H-SiC, and 6H-SiC, each possessing distinct structural and electronic properties.

The 3C-SiC polytype, also known as cubic silicon carbide (β-SiC), has a zinc blende crystal structure, similar to diamond. It is generally formed at lower temperatures compared to other SiC polytypes. While it has a relatively smaller bandgap (around 2.36 eV), its cubic symmetry can be advantageous for certain applications.

In contrast, the alpha-SiC (α-SiC) family, which includes the widely studied 4H-SiC and 6H-SiC polytypes, exhibits hexagonal or rhombohedral crystal structures. These polytypes are typically formed at higher temperatures. The 4H-SiC polytype, with a bandgap of approximately 3.23 eV, is particularly favored for high-power and high-frequency electronic devices. Its electronic properties, such as higher electron mobility and critical breakdown electric field, make it superior to 3C-SiC and traditional silicon for demanding applications.

The 6H-SiC polytype, also hexagonal, has a bandgap of about 3.02 eV and has historically been important for early light-emitting diodes (LEDs). While its electronic properties are not as advantageous as 4H-SiC for high-power applications, its established characterization and production methods make it a relevant material.

These differences in crystal structure directly influence SiC's macroscopic properties. For instance, the wide bandgap of SiC (particularly 4H-SiC) allows it to withstand higher operating temperatures and voltages without electrical breakdown. Its high thermal conductivity ensures efficient heat dissipation, crucial for preventing device failure in high-power applications. The mechanical properties of SiC, such as its extreme hardness and resistance to wear, are also linked to its strong covalent Si-C bonds, making it suitable for abrasive and structural uses.

The ability to control and tailor these polytypes and their properties through manufacturing processes like Physical Vapor Transport (PVT) and Chemical Vapor Deposition (CVD) is what makes SiC such a powerful material.
